Transaction e27a901b5f7ae153ae40b1aa1ded34aa78f147651ccfb0b8e125aa8be37196e3
1 Input
1 Output
-
e27a901b5f7ae153ae40b1aa1ded34aa78f147651ccfb0b8e125aa8be37196e3:0
- value
- 289859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d0a74b91b5d3e9d6405fa41b768e597ea5119c OP_EQUAL
- address
- 3DXR3niSRTWfzAiMAaDZTnUtzqvSmDWzaq